Top 5 NFT Games Performance in Oceania for Q1 2023
Discover the performance trends of the top 5 NFT games in Oceania for Q1 2023, including downloads, active users, and revenue insights.
In the first quarter of 2023, the top 5 NFT games in Oceania demonstrated varying performance trends in terms of downloads, active users, and revenue. Below is a detailed analysis based on Sensor Tower data.
Highrise: Avatar, Chat & Games from PocketzWorld Inc. saw a fluctuating trend in revenue, peaking at around $14.4K in the week of January 23. Weekly downloads showed a decline mid-quarter, dropping from 5.3K in early January to approximately 2.7K by the end of March. Active users also saw a downward trend, starting at 17K in early January and ending the quarter at around 12K.
MIR4 by Wemade Co., Ltd. experienced significant revenue growth, reaching a high of $20.6K in the week of February 6. Downloads remained relatively low throughout the quarter, with a notable spike to 151 in the last week of March. The active user base remained stable, hovering around 600-700 users.
IMVU: 3D Avatar Creator & Chat from IMVU maintained a consistent revenue stream, with a peak of $9.3K in mid-February. Downloads fluctuated, with a high of 3.6K in late February and a low of 1.2K in mid-March. Active users showed an upward trend, increasing from 12K in late December to over 16K by the end of February, before stabilizing around 13K.
COIN: Always Be Earning from Xy Labs, Inc. displayed stable revenue, peaking at $1.4K in the last week of February. Active users saw a slight decline, dropping from 1.9K in early January to about 1.2K by the end of March. There were no significant download figures reported for the quarter.
Crypto Conflict by JOYCITY Corp showed a downward revenue trend, starting at $1.9K in late December and falling to $311 by the end of March. Active users gradually decreased from 35 in late December to just 10 by the end of March. Download numbers remained negligible throughout the quarter.
